A trip of a lifetime. Great guides covering Tarangire National Park, Lake Manyana, Ngorongoro crater and southern Serengeti,...
A trip of a lifetime. Great guides covering Tarangire National Park, Lake Manyana, Ngorongoro crater and southern Serengeti, where we saw herds of elephants, giraffes, antelope, zebra, wildebeast, cape buffalo, eland, jackels, hyenas, mongeese, hippopotomi, rhinoceroses, lion, leopard, cheetah and loads more. This was followed by a more relaxing period on the beaches of Zanzibar, where we snorkelled with dolphins and amongst the numerous fish living on the coral reef.
Every day on safari, we woke thinking that the day could not be better than the previous one but were consistenly wrong.
The fixed accomodation was excellent, the mobile camp was more agricultural as expected. Food across the various locations was good to great.
Definitely worth the money, with incredible experiences

Our private family safari to Tanzania couldn't be better! Dev in the home office was super well-organised and...
Our private family safari to Tanzania couldn’t be better! Dev in the home office was super well-organised and answered all our questions promptly and accurately. The safari was very well organised. Frank was the best driver/guide we could ever hope for: personable, knowledgeable and possessing a seemingly superhuman ability to spot all types of game while carefully driving the safari vehicle. All the lodges we stayed at on our safari were each, in their own way, special.
It was downright amazing to be driving all day in the African bush and then drive up to a beautiful luxury lodge at the end of a long game drive. Each one was unique in its own way. All of us will long remember the outdoor shower at Lahia Tented Camp overlooking the Great Migration just below us, as just one example. We viewed tens of thousands of large African mammals. In short, I highly recommend our private, luxury 13-day Tanzania Family Safari.
